- (1) The director may validate an individual owner or operator of a resort or marina to fish for herring if the owner or operator submits proof to the department in the form of a notarized affidavit that he or she is unable to purchase live, fresh, or frozen herring (dependent on need) from at least three commercial sources at a fair market price.
(2) The following conditions apply to validations granted to resort or marina owners or operators:
- (a) Validations are for one calendar year only;
- (b) The director may only renew a validation after receipt of a new affidavit; and
- (c) Validations are nontransferable.
- (3) It is unlawful to fish for herring in Puget Sound Marine Fish-Shellfish Areas 20A, 20B, 21A, and 21B from April 16 to May 31.
- (4) Herring caught under this section must be sold at retail only for bait by, and at, the resort or marina the department validates to fish for herring.
- (5) The department will revoke validations it grants under subsection (1) of this section if the owner or operator violates the conditions of the validation.
- (6) Violation of this section is a misdemeanor, punishable under RCW 77.15.750, Unlawful use of a department permit—Penalty.
